In Lawrence County, Indiana, ZIP 47420 scores 20 of 100 for composite distress, a low level on DLRadar's public-record index. Its standout signals are institutional ownership (52/100), structural risk (44/100). The latent-versus-live split is 44/100 structural and 0/100 already moving. It additionally carries heavy environmental risk: flood (NFIP) exposure (80/100), FEMA disaster exposure (64/100).

The market reads peak — home values rose 4.4% year on year (phase confidence 32/100). Topping markets hide individual distress behind strong averages.

Educational attainment sits at 33% bachelor's-or-above. The ZIP holds roughly 44 housing units. About 77 people live here, median age 53. The vacancy rate is 0.0%. DLRadar's demographic-stress index for the area reads 19/100. 19.5% of residents fall below the poverty threshold. Owners hold 100% of homes, renters 0%.
